Caution:
Under operating systems Windows XP and Windows Server 2003, if other USB interfaces of PC
connected to USB interface of printer firstly. The system will also Pop-up "Add New Hardware
Wizard". If you have already installed USB device driver according to above steps, select "Automatic
installation" and click "Next", the wizard will search driver automatically, then the digital signature
interface will pop-up. Click on "Yes", and click "Finish" to end the installation.

4.12 How to Use the Driver

After installing the driver, you can print all characters and images in WORD, EXCEL or other file in
Windows programs, That is ''What You See Is What You Get''. In order to print normally, you should set
the page and select parameters properly.

4.12.1 User defined page

If the page size defined by the driver can not meet user's requirement, user can define the page size;
under Window 98 system, user defined page can be defined via page settings. But under Windows
NT4.0/ Windows 2000/ Windows XP/ Windows server 2003/Vista, user cannot define page size via page
settings. The following steps introduce how to define page size (take Windows XP system as an
example):
1)
Ensure the system running normally.
2)
Click "Start" button.
3)
Click "Printers and faxes" in "Settings" item; or first click "Control panel" button, then click "Printers
and other hardware" in "Control panel", next click "Printers and faxes" button.
4)
After selecting BTP-M280, click "File" menus, then click "Service Properties" submenus
5)
In "Forms" item, select "Create a new form".
6)
Define a name of self-defining paper in "Form name".
